Canadian Forward Sortation Area Boundaries/Points (FSA)
FSAs are areas corresponding to the first three digits of the six digit Canadian postal code and determined based upon volume of mail. The first letter of the FSA indicates a province, territory or other major Postal Sector of which there are17. The second letter of the Postal Code indicates whether the address falls in a rural or urban area. This file is maintained by MapInfo and includes both urban and rural FSAs.
